İçindekiler:
- Adım 1: Malzeme Gereksinimleri
- 2. Adım: Bağlantı
- Adım 3: Kütüphane Kurulumu
- 4. Adım: Kodu Yükleyin
- Adım 5:
Video: Oled Ekran Programlama: 5 Adım
2024 Yazar: John Day | [email protected]. Son düzenleme: 2024-01-30 13:18
Oled en basit ve etkili ekrandır. Giyilebilir cihazlar veya her türlü izleme cihazı yapabilirsiniz. OLED kullanarak hava durumu istasyonu yapabilir veya komik animasyonlar görüntüleyebilirsiniz. OLED ekranla ilgili birçok DIY makalesinde arama yapıyorum, bununla ilgili uygun bir açıklama yok. O yüzden bu yazımızda OLED'i en basit şekilde programlayacağız.
Adım 1: Malzeme Gereksinimleri
Arduino UNO * 1
Oled Ekran * 1
atlama telleri
Ekmek tahtası * 1
Programlama kablosu * 1
2. Adım: Bağlantı
Piyasada birçok Oled çeşidi vardır ancak bunlar temel olarak Seri veya I2C protokolü üzerinden haberleşirler.
Pin adı farklı olabilir, ona göre bir tablo veriyorum, onları bağlayabilirsiniz.
Bu tabloyu Circuitdigest.com'dan kullanıyorum
Ara veya uzman için çok ayrıntılı bir açıklamaları var. Yeni başlayan biriyseniz, OLED'inizi tabloya göre bağlamanız ve bir sonraki adıma geçmeniz yeterlidir.
Adım 3: Kütüphane Kurulumu
Arduino ide yazılımınız yoksa açın, www.electronicsmith.com web siteme bakın Arduino yazılımını nasıl indirip kuracağınızı 2 adımda detaylı olarak anlatıyorum.
Serch çıplak yazmada ctrl+shift+i tuşlarına basın
ada meyvesi ssd1306
ilk seçeneği yükle
4. Adım: Kodu Yükleyin
Örnek kodu yükleyeceğiz.
açık
dosya > örnek > Adafruit SSD1306 > ssd1306_128x64_spi
Arduino UNO'nuzu bağlayın ve kodu yükleyin.
Adım 5:
OLED ekranınızda bir demo animasyonu başlar
Giyilebilir bir akıllı saat, hava durumu istasyonu veya masaüstü saati vb. yapabilirsiniz.
Bunlardan herhangi birini yapmayı planlıyorsanız, NextPCB.com size yüksek kaliteli PCB sağlamak için burada. özel renk seçenekleri ve hızlı teslimat. En iyi bölüm, minimum miktar gerektirmemesi ve anında teklif vermesidir. Buraya bir link bırakıyorum bir kez kontrol etmeliyim.
www. SonrakiPCB.com
Önerilen:
Z80-MBC2 Atmega32a'yı Programlama: 6 Adım
Z80-MBC2 Atmega32a'yı Programlama: z80-MBC2'yi kullanmadan önce, oluşturduktan sonra Atmeg32'yi programlamanız gerekir. Bu talimat, kodu yüklemek için programcı olarak ucuz bir arduino mini'yi nasıl kullanacağınızı gösterir
KOLAY Sonsuz Ayna Küpü Yapın - 3D Baskı YOK ve Programlama YOK: 15 Adım (Resimlerle)
KOLAY Sonsuz Ayna Küpü Yapın | 3D Baskı YOK ve Programlama YOK: Herkes iyi bir sonsuzluk küpünü sever, ancak bunları yapmak zor olacak gibi görünüyor. Bu Eğitilebilirlik için amacım, size adım adım nasıl yapılacağını göstermektir. Sadece bu değil, size verdiğim talimatlarla bir tane yapabileceksiniz
Dokunmatik Ekran Macintosh - Ekran için IPad Mini'li Klasik Mac: 5 Adım (Resimlerle)
Dokunmatik Ekran Macintosh | Ekran için IPad Mini'li Klasik Mac: Bu, eski bir Macintosh'un ekranının bir iPad mini ile nasıl değiştirileceğine ilişkin güncellemem ve gözden geçirilmiş tasarımım. Bu, yıllar içinde yaptığım 6'ncı ve bunun evrimi ve tasarımından oldukça memnunum! 2013'te yaptığım zaman
Micropython ile TTGO (renkli) Ekran (TTGO T-ekran): 6 Adım
Micropython'lu TTGO (renkli) Ekran (TTGO T-ekran): TTGO T-Display, 1,14 inç renkli ekran içeren ESP32 tabanlı bir karttır. Pano 7$'dan daha düşük bir ödülle satın alınabilir (nakliye dahil, banggood'da görülen ödül). Bu, ekran içeren bir ESP32 için inanılmaz bir ödül. T
Daha Büyük Bir Ekran Oluşturmak için Başa Monte Ekran (HMD) Hack/modifikasyonu: 8 Adım
Daha Büyük Bir Ekran Oluşturmak için Head Mounted Dispaly (HMD) Hack/modifikasyonu: Merhaba…. ilk talimatlarımda size Wild Planet'ten monokrom HMD'yi nasıl hackleyeceğinizi/değiştireceğinizi göstermek istiyorum. Bu değişiklik her şeyi KÜÇÜK yapar ve size bir SİNEMADA oturduğunuzu hissettirir !!! Dezavantajı ise